-int capture(
- class zmq::socket_base_t *capture_,
- zmq::msg_t& msg_,
- int more_ = 0)
-{
- // Copy message to capture socket if any
- if (capture_) {
- zmq::msg_t ctrl;
- int rc = ctrl.init ();
- if (unlikely (rc < 0))
- return -1;
- rc = ctrl.copy (msg_);
- if (unlikely (rc < 0))
- return -1;
- rc = capture_->send (&ctrl, more_? ZMQ_SNDMORE: 0);
- if (unlikely (rc < 0))
- return -1;
- }
- return 0;
-}
-
-int forward(
- class zmq::socket_base_t *from_,
- class zmq::socket_base_t *to_,
- class zmq::socket_base_t *capture_,
- zmq::msg_t& msg_)
-{
- int more;
- size_t moresz;
- while (true) {
- int rc = from_->recv (&msg_, 0);
- if (unlikely (rc < 0))
- return -1;
-
- moresz = sizeof more;
- rc = from_->getsockopt (ZMQ_RCVMORE, &more, &moresz);
- if (unlikely (rc < 0))
- return -1;
-
- // Copy message to capture socket if any
- rc = capture(capture_, msg_, more);
- if (unlikely (rc < 0))
- return -1;
-
- rc = to_->send (&msg_, more? ZMQ_SNDMORE: 0);
- if (unlikely (rc < 0))
- return -1;
- if (more == 0)
- break;
- }
- return 0;
-}

-int zmq::proxy (
- class socket_base_t *frontend_,
- class socket_base_t *backend_,
- class socket_base_t *capture_,
- class socket_base_t *control_)
-{
- msg_t msg;
- int rc = msg.init ();
- if (rc != 0)
- return -1;
-
- // The algorithm below assumes ratio of requests and replies processed
- // under full load to be 1:1.
-
- int more;
- size_t moresz;
- zmq_pollitem_t items [] = {
- { frontend_, 0, ZMQ_POLLIN, 0 },
- { backend_, 0, ZMQ_POLLIN, 0 },
- { control_, 0, ZMQ_POLLIN, 0 }
- };
- int qt_poll_items = (control_ ? 3 : 2);
- zmq_pollitem_t itemsout [] = {
- { frontend_, 0, ZMQ_POLLOUT, 0 },
- { backend_, 0, ZMQ_POLLOUT, 0 }
- };
-
- // Proxy can be in these three states
- enum {
- active,
- paused,
- terminated
- } state = active;
-
- while (state != terminated) {
- // Wait while there are either requests or replies to process.
- rc = zmq_poll (&items [0], qt_poll_items, -1);
- if (unlikely (rc < 0))
- return -1;
-
- // Get the pollout separately because when combining this with pollin it maxes the CPU
- // because pollout shall most of the time return directly.
- // POLLOUT is only checked when frontend and backend sockets are not the same.
- if (frontend_ != backend_) {
- rc = zmq_poll (&itemsout [0], 2, 0);
- if (unlikely (rc < 0)) {
- return -1;
- }
- }
-
- // Process a control command if any
- if (control_ && items [2].revents & ZMQ_POLLIN) {
- rc = control_->recv (&msg, 0);
- if (unlikely (rc < 0))
- return -1;
-
- moresz = sizeof more;
- rc = control_->getsockopt (ZMQ_RCVMORE, &more, &moresz);
- if (unlikely (rc < 0) || more)
- return -1;
-
- // Copy message to capture socket if any
- rc = capture(capture_, msg);
- if (unlikely (rc < 0))
- return -1;
-
- if (msg.size () == 5 && memcmp (msg.data (), "PAUSE", 5) == 0)
- state = paused;
- else
- if (msg.size () == 6 && memcmp (msg.data (), "RESUME", 6) == 0)
- state = active;
- else
- if (msg.size () == 9 && memcmp (msg.data (), "TERMINATE", 9) == 0)
- state = terminated;
- else {
- // This is an API error, we should assert
- puts ("E: invalid command sent to proxy");
- zmq_assert (false);
- }
- }
- // Process a request
- if (state == active
- && items [0].revents & ZMQ_POLLIN
- && (frontend_ == backend_ || itemsout [1].revents & ZMQ_POLLOUT)) {
- rc = forward(frontend_, backend_, capture_,msg);
- if (unlikely (rc < 0))
- return -1;
- }
- // Process a reply
- if (state == active
- && frontend_ != backend_
- && items [1].revents & ZMQ_POLLIN
- && itemsout [0].revents & ZMQ_POLLOUT) {
- rc = forward(backend_, frontend_, capture_,msg);
- if (unlikely (rc < 0))
- return -1;
- }
- }
- return 0;
-}
